    Who is Dr. Chang, Hematology / Oncology Specialist in Bakersfield, CA?

    Dr. James Chang, MD is a Hematology / Oncology Specialist, who primarily practices in Bakersfield, CA. He is board certified. Dr. Chang graduated from Taipei Med University and completed his residency at Lac-King/Drew Med Ctr, Hematology/Oncology; Hurley Med Ctr, Internal Medicine.     What does a Hematology / Oncology Specialist do?

    An internist doctor of osteopathy specializing in the combined treatment of hematology and oncology disorders. A doctor of osteopathy who is board eligible or certified by the American Osteopathic Board of Internal Medicine was previously able to obtain a Certificate of Special Qualifications in Hematology and Oncology; however, this certificate is no longer available.
